BEEF AND BEAN STEW



Beef and Bean Stew image

This Beef and Bean Stew is how to fall in love with beans. Loaded with flavor, tender beef and buttery beans. One of the yummiest ways to stay warm in the winter.

Provided by Heather

Categories     Dinner

Time 2h30m

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 lb navy beans (*or white bean of choice (see Note 1 below), approximately 2 cups)
2 tsp salt
3 tbsp oil (*I used avocado oil)
2 1/2- 3 lbs chuck roast (*cut into 1 inch pieces)
1 lg brown onion (*diced, about 2 cups)
4 med carrots (*cut into rounds)
6 lg cloves garlic (*crushed or diced)
1/2 cup red wine
1/2 tbsp basil
1 tsp marjoram
2 bay leaves
28 oz diced canned tomatoes (*with juice)
1 qt beef broth
8 oz fresh baby spinach
salt & p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Rinse beans well in a colander.
  • Place into lining of Instant Pot. Add 8 cups of water to beans and stir in salt.
  • Attach lid and close valve to sealed. Cook on high pressure for 30 mins. (See Note 2 below for cooking times of other white bean choices.)
  • Once cooked, allow beans to do a natural release for 30 mins and then do a quick release. Drain beans of water. (See Note 3 below.)
  • Cut meat and pat dry excess moisture. Generously salt and pepper. (See Note 4 below)
  • Place a large enameled dutch oven over medium/high heat with oil until oil is bubbly, about 2-3 mins. Working in batches of 3, brown the beef. Setting aside each browned batch into one large bowl.
  • Once beef is browned, sauté onions in beef drippings, about 3 mins.
  • Add in carrots and continue sautéing for another 3 mins. Add garlic and saute an additional min.
  • Add in wine and stir well.
  • Return beef to dutch oven. Add tomatoes, herbs and beef broth. Stir well.
  • Bring to a boil over medium/high heat and lower heat to a simmer. Cover, stir occasionally and cook for approximately 1 hour- 1 hour and 20 mins or until beef is tender.
  • Once stew has simmered and beef is tender, stir in beans and continue simmering for another 25 mins.
  • Working in batches, stir in spinach and continue simmering for another 5 mins or until spinach is cooked.

BEEF AND BEAN STEW



Beef and Bean Stew image

A large bowl of this stew on a chilly autumn day will quickly warm you up. It's great with a thick slice of homemade bread.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h50m

Yield 6-8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on paprika
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
2-1/2 to 3 pounds beef stew meat, cut into 1-inch cubes
3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
2 medium onions, thinly sliced
2 cups water
1 can (6 ounces) tomato paste
3/4 teaspoon rubbed sage
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
1 can (16 ounces) kidney beans, rinsed and drained

Steps:

  • In a large resealable plastic bag, combine the flour, paprika, salt and cayenne. Add beef, a few pieces at a time, and shake to coat. In a Dutch oven over medium heat, brown beef in 2 tablespoons oil. Remove with a slotted spoon; set aside. , In the same pan, saute onions in the remaining oil until crisp-tender. Add the water, tomato paste, sage and thyme. Return beef to pan. Bring to a boil; reduce heat. Cover and simmer for 1-1/4 hours, stirring occasionally. , Add more water if needed. Stir in beans. Cover and simmer 15 minutes longer or until meat is tender.

SPICY BEEF STEW WITH BEANS & PEPPERS



Spicy beef stew with beans & peppers image

Just the thing to warm you up on a cold winter night

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Dinner, Lunch, Main course, Supper

Time 3h

Yield Serves 6 adults, or 4 adults and 4 kids

Number Of Ingredients 12

3 ½ tbsp vegetable oil
1kg stewing beef , cut into chunks
1 onion , sliced
2 garlic cloves , sliced
1 tbsp plain flour
1 tbsp black treacle
1 tsp cumin
400g can chopped tomato
600ml beef stock (from a cube is fine)
2 red peppers , deseeded and sliced
400g can cannellini bean , drained and rinsed
soured cream and coriander, to serve

Steps:

  • Heat 1 tbsp of oil in a large saucepan with a lid. Season meat, then cook about one-third over a high heat for 10 mins until browned. Tip onto a plate and repeat with 2 tbsp of oil and rest of the meat.
  • Add a splash of water and scrape pan to remove bits. Add ½ tbsp oil. Turn heat down, fry onion and garlic until softened. Return meat to the pan, add flour and stir for 1 min. Add treacle, cumin, tomatoes and stock. Bring to boil, reduce heat, cover and simmer for 1 hr 45 mins. Stir occasionally and check that the meat is covered with liquid.
  • Add peppers and beans, and cook for a further 15 mins. The stew can now be cooled and kept in the fridge for 2 days, or frozen for 1 month. Serve in bowls, with sour cream, coriander and cornbread.

PINTO BEAN AND BEEF STEW



Pinto Bean and Beef Stew image

This savory pinto bean and ground beef stew is perfect for cilantro lovers. The combination of Mexican spices makes this a quick family favorite. Serve with cornbread.

Provided by Angela Naumann

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ews     Beef

Time 9h50m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 cup dried pinto beans
1 pound ground beef
1 teaspoon seasoned salt (such as Spike® seasoning)
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 onion, chopped
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 tablespoon ground cumin
1 tablespoon dried cilantro
2 teaspoons dried Mexican oregano
1 (14.5 ounce) can petite diced tomatoes
4 cups chicken broth
1 cup water, or more as needed
2 tablespoons tomato paste
½ cup diced green onions
½ cup chopped fresh cilantro, or more to taste
2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lime juice

Steps:

  • Place pinto beans into a pot and cover with several inches of cool water; let soak, 8 hours to overnight.
  • Drain beans and add fresh water to cover. Bring to a boil; reduce heat and let simmer until beans are soft, 40 to 45 minutes.
  • While beans are cooking, he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ook and stir ground beef with seasoned salt in the hot skillet until browned and crumbly, 5 to 7 minutes. Remove from heat and set aside.
  •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add onion and saute until soft, translucent, and starting to brown, about 5 minutes. Add garlic and saute for 2 minutes more. Add cumin, dried cilantro, and Mexican oregano and saute for 1 minute more.
  • Drain beans. Mix with browned beef, onion mixture, diced tomatoes, chicken broth, 1 cup water, and tomato paste in a heavy stockpot. Simmer over low heat for 45 minutes, adding more water as needed to achieve desired consistency for the stew.
  • Add green onion, cilantro, and lime juice. Serve hot.

OLD-FASHIONED BEEF STEW



Old-Fashioned Beef Stew image

I took my Grandmother's recipe, trimmed the fat and enhanced the flavor.

Provided by CORWYNN DARKHOLME

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ews     Beef

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 pound lean beef chuck, trimmed and cut into 1 inch cubes
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ons vegetable oil
2 onions, thinly sliced
2 cups fresh sliced mushrooms
2 cloves garlic, minced
2 teaspoons tomato paste
2 cups beef broth
4 cups sliced carrots
2 russet potatoes, sliced into 1/4 inch slices
1 cup chopped fresh green beans
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1 tablespoon cold water
¼ cup chopped parsley

Steps:

  • Coat beef with flour, shaking off excess. In a large nonstick stock pot, heat oil over medium-high heat, add beef and saute until brown, approximately 6 minutes. Remove beef from stock pot and set aside.
  • Add onions and mushrooms to stock pot and saute for 6 minutes. Add garlic and saute for 1 minute, continually stirring.
  • Skim off fat any fat from the stock pot and return cooked beef to pot; stir in tomato paste and broth. Add enough water to just cover ingredients and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er until beef is tender, about 1 hour and 15 minutes.
  • Skim off any foam that has accumulated on the surface of stew and add carrots, potatoes and green beans. Cover partially and simmer for 15 minutes.
  • In a small mixing bowl, mix cornstarch and cold water. Stir mixture into stew. Increase heat and boil uncovered for 1 minute. Sprinkle with parsley and serve.

BEEF & BEAN KHORESH (A PERSIAN BEEF STEW)



Beef & Bean Khoresh (a Persian Beef Stew) image

This is simply lean beef and kidney beans in a delicious cinnamon and cumin-scented stew, with lots of parsley and chives and a splash of lemon juice. The unusual color is from turmeric, and it's best served with rice.

Provided by EdsGirlAngie

Categories     Stew

Time 1h40m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

3 tablespoons olive oil, divided (2 tbsp. and 1 tbsp.)
1/2 large onion, chopped
1 lb lean stewing beef, cubed
2 teaspoons ground cumin
2 teaspoons ground turmeric
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
2 1/2 cups water
5 tablespoons fresh flat-leaf parsley, chopped
3 tablespoons snipped chives
1 (15 ounce) can kidney beans, drained and rinsed
1 lemon, juice of
1 tablespoon flour
salt and black pepper

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an saute the onion in two tablespoons of the olive oil until golden.
  • Add stewing beef and cook for ten minutes more, until meat is browned on all sides.
  • Add the cumin, turmeric and cinnamon; cook for one minute, stirring, then add water and bring to a boil.
  • Cover and simmer over low heat for 45 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Heat remaining one tablespooon of oil in a small frying pan and saute parsley and chives about 2 minutes; add this mixture to the beef.
  • Also add the drained and rinsed kidney beans and lemon juice.
  • Season with salt and pepper.
  • Stir in one tablespoon flour whisked with a bit of hot water to thicken the stew a little; simmer uncovered for another 30 minutes, until meat is wonderfully tender; serve with rice.

BEANY BEEF CHILLI STEW WITH CRUNCHY TORTILLA CROUTONS



Beany beef chilli stew with crunchy tortilla croutons image

Add beans and lentils to this stew for texture and to stretch the meat further. They're also a good source of protein and vitamins, and cost-efficient too

Provided by Cassie Best

Categories     Dinner

Time 3h20m

Number Of Ingredients 24

2 tbsp olive or rapeseed oil
500g braising beef (skirt, chuck or brisket all work well)
2 onions, chopped
4 garlic cloves, crushed
1 tbsp ground cumin
2 tsp ground coriander
2 tsp smoked paprika
1 tsp ground cinnamon
2 tbsp tomato purée
400g can chopped tomatoes
1-2 tbsp chipotle paste (optional)
2 beef stock cubes
100g brown lentils
400g can black beans, drained
400g can kidney beans, drained
1-2 tsp light brown soft sugar (optional)
4 corn tortilla wraps
vegetable oil, for frying
100g feta, crumbled
50g soured cream or natural yogurt
small bunch of coriander, leaves picked
1 avocado, stoned, peeled, halved and sliced
1 large red chilli, thinly sliced
1 lime, cut into wedges

Steps:

  • Heat half the oil in a large flameproof casserole over a medium-high heat. Tip in enough beef to cover the base of the pan in a single layer, being careful not to overcrowd the pan. Brown the beef on each side, turning until it has a deep brown crust all over - this will give the stew a deep, beefy flavour. Remove to a plate using a slotted spoon and continue cooking until all the beef is browned. Set aside.
  • Heat the remaining oil in the same pan, then tip in the onions, reduce the heat to low-medium and sizzle for 8-10 mins until soft, stirring and scraping the base of the pan to lift any browned bits.
  • Add the garlic, cumin, coriander, paprika, cinnamon and tomato purée. Stir for 1-2 mins until the spices are sizzling and aromatic, then tip in the chopped tomatoes and chipotle paste, if using, and crumble in the stock cubes. Return the beef to the pan with any resting juices, pour in 1.2 litres water, season and bring to a simmer.
  • Once bubbling, reduce the heat to low, cover with a lid and simmer for 1 hr 45 mins, stirring occasionally. Meanwhile, tip the lentils into a bowl, cover with cold water and leave to soak. Drain, then add to the stew, cover again and continue to cook for 45 mins more, or until the beef and lentils are tender.
  • Tip in all the beans, return to a simmer and bubble for 5 mins until the beans are warmed through. If your stew is soupy and you prefer it thicker, boil, uncovered, for a few minutes more until reduced to your liking. Taste for seasoning and add more salt or chipotle paste, if you like; it may also need some sugar depending on the tomatoes you've used (add up to 2 tsp). Will keep chilled for two days or frozen for two months. Leave to cool completely first.
  • If making the tortilla croutons, cut the wraps into small triangles and heat enough oil to cover the base of a deep frying pan. Fry over a medium heat for 2-3 mins, tossing in the pan until crisp. Or, simply crumble tortilla chips to make a quick, crunchy topping.
  • Serve the stew in bowls topped with your choice of feta, soured cream or yogurt, coriander, avocado and sliced chilli, lime wedges on the side for squeezing over and the tortilla croutons. Grind over some black pepper, if you like, before serving.
